Military production minster probes bilateral cooperation with CETC

Egyptian Minister of State for Military Production Mohamed Ahmed Morsi toured on Thursday the pavilion of China Electronic Technology Group Corporation (CETC) in Egypt Defense Expo (EDEX 2021).

During the tour, the minister was posted on the latest up-to-date technological techniques and advances incorporated by the company.

The tour came on the fourth and last day of the forum that kicked off here on Monday.

The minister hailed deeply rooted ties binding Egypt and China in the various spheres, highlighting president Abdel Fatah El Sisi’s recent visits to China.

Morsi further lauded the Chinese distinguished participation in EDEX 2021.

For his part, Spokesman for the Ministry of State for Military Production Mohamed Eid Bakr affirmed Egyptian-Chinese keenness on fostering startegic cooperation in the various domains.

The two sides agreed on further promoting cooperation, as well as exchanging visits among both countries’ officials, scientific and research expertise, with a view to serving Egyptian-Chinese interests.

CETC is a backbone state-owned enterprise in China. It was officially established in March 1st, 2002.

EDEX 2021 houses the pavilions of Egypt, Saudi Arabia, UAE, France, United States and South Korea among others. More than 300 companies belonging to 18 countries, including Egypt, are exhibiting their products at EDEX 2021, which is visited by 76 foreign military delegations.
